Bairnsdale Blue Light Disco Gets OnlinePromoting safe entertainment to the world By Emma Kae - 13th November 2001 - Back to News The Bairnsdale Blue Light Disco Team organises a great night out for local youth in a safe, supervised, drug and alcohol free environment. The team currently works to provide entertainment for the youth, to promote safe behaviour and encourage good relationships between young people and police. Now they have gone one step further with an online contribution, promoting Blue Light Disco’s to the world.


The website offers news updates, newsletters to keep you informed, information about the discos, a brief history of the blue light tradition, a photo gallery and an events calendar to keep you informed about up-and-coming evenings. Why not drop by? Click here to visit the website.
